When you are building a turnkey ecommerce site, it pays to shop around for the best package for your money. Not all turnkey solutions are created equal, and not all will offer the best solutions for your unique business needs. While pricing will certainly come into play as you build your turnkey ecommerce site, you will also want to make sure that the features of the package you are considering will be a good fit for your company. We have some of the characteristics to look for when you are building an effective, successful turnkey ecommerce site.
Turnkey solutions are quicker and easier than other types of website design, because there is less customization involved in the process. Because you are receiving few consultations and less professional advice, a turnkey ecommerce site is usually a cost effective way to get your business up and running. However, if the package doesn’t include features that your company requires, you may end up spending more in the long run for additional solutions on top of the package you are purchasing. That’s why it is worth the time to shop around until you find the best fit in a turnkey ecommerce site for you.

A turnkey ecommerce site is much quicker to build because the templates are already created and all you have to do is provide your company’s information. That is not to say that your website will not be professionally designed with your business in mind. A professional turnkey ecommerce site designer should take all of your information like your products’ names, descriptions, details and images and install them onto your website. Charges for these services will usually be in batches of a particular amount, such as up to 500 items, between 500 and 1000 items, etc. This is a cost effective way to get all of your products listed on your turnkey ecommerce site for your customers’ shopping pleasure.
Just because you are creating a turnkey ecommerce site doesn’t mean you won’t need assistance getting that website up and running. When you are shopping for a turnkey ecommerce site designer, find out ho much customer support is available in the package. It is a good idea to ask about phone consultations that are included in the package, since live help is often necessary to work out the bugs of installing a turnkey ecommerce site. Most packages will include a set amount of customer support and then charge for anything over and above that amount. If you want to avoid paying a high price to work out problems and get the site running smoothly, ask about the amount of customer support that is included up front
A turnkey ecommerce site is a cost effective way to get your business up and running online, but only if the package you purchase will meet the needs of your company. Find out what is included in terms of product information and customer support to ensure you won’t be spending extra cash for add on solutions, and your turnkey package might be the perfect solution for your business.
